Jones's Roundleaf Bat vs Pacific Spiny-rat

Hipposideros jonesi compared with Proechimys decumanus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Jones's Roundleaf Bat Pacific Spiny-rat
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Mammalia (Mammals)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Chiroptera (Bats) Rodentia (Rodents)
Family Hipposideridae Echimyidae
Genus Hipposideros Proechimys
Species Hipposideros jonesi Proechimys decumanus

Evolutionary Relationship

Jones's Roundleaf Bat and Pacific Spiny-rat share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
